USER MANUAL HM4 Duronic

  • Please read these instructions carefully and keep it for future reference
  • This appliance has been made for domestic use only and not for commercial use.
  • Appliances can be used by persons with re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ities or lack of experience and knowledge if they have been given supervision or instruction concerning the use of the appliance in a safe way and if they understand the hazards involved.
  • Keep the appliance and its cord out of reach of children unless close supervision is provided by a responsible adult.
  • Always disconnect the mixer from the mains supply if it is not being used, left unattended or being disassembled.
  • If the supply cord is damaged, it must be replaced by the manufacturer, its service agent or a qualied person in order to avoid a hazard.
  • Always store the mixer away in a safe, cool and dry place after use.
  • Insert only original parts, made by Duronic (dough hooks, beaters).
  • Do not use outdoors.
  • Never immerse the unit in water or any other liquids.
  • Do not use it with wet hands.
  • If the appliance should become wet or damp, remove the plug from the mains socket immediately and allow it to dry.
  • Use this appliance only for its intended purpose.
  • Never touch the rotating accessories while they are still in motion; always wait for them to stop.
  • To avoid splashes, always put the dough hooks or beater right into the mixture before operating.
  • Never use this appliance to mix or stir anything other than ingredients.
  • Do not use this appliance to mix boiling water.

Preparing the dough hooks or beaters Always check the mixer is switched off at the mains before attaching any accessories. Inserting the accessories - Insert the two beaters (7) into corresponding holes, turn slightly clockwise until they lock into place. - Insert the two dough hooks (8) into corresponding holes, turn slightly until they lock into place. - Never use beaters and dough hooks together. - After use, Store the dough hooks and beaters in the storage box(9) To remove dough hooks or beaters To detach dough hooks / beaters, press the ejection button (1). The ejection button will not work if the speed is not at the “0” position. Short-time operation The appliance is designed to process average domestic quantities of food; it can be operated without interruption for a maximum of 10 minutes, then it should be allowed to cool down to room temperature before continuing operation. How to operate your whisk Use the whisk only for whipping cream, beating egg whites and mixing sponges and ready-mix desserts. Insert the whisk (part 10) to the motor part until it locks. Place the whisk into a beaker / container and then adjust the speed control to mix the food. Operating Procedure

1. Ensure the speed control position is at “0”.

3. Lock your chosen accessory into place and it is ready to use.

Speed control “0” Stop “1” Dough hook: butter, potatoes “2” Beater/Whisk: sauces, egg, milk, dairy etc “3” Dough hooks: light pastry dough “4” Beaters/Whisk: whipped desserts, cream “5” Beaters/Whisk: egg whites, whipped cream “Turbo” For a short high-speed burst; push the turbo button and release (Pulse action). This product is tted with CE:1363 plug and fuse Imported by Shine-Mart Ltd, RM3 8SB Information on waste Disposal for Consumers of Electrical & Electronic Equipment. This mark on a product and/or accompanying documents indicates that when it is to be disposed of, it must be treated as Waste Electrical & Electronic Equipment, (WEEE). Any WEEE marked products must not be mixed with general household waste, but kept separate for the treatment, recovery and recycling of the materials used. For proper treatment, recovery and recycling; please take all WEEE marked waste to your Local Authority Civic waste site, where it will be accepted free of charge. If customers dispose of Waste Electrical & Electronic Equipment correctly, they will be helping to save valuable resources and preventing any potential negative effects upon human health and the environment, of any hazardous materials that the waste may contain.
